Indiana Attorney General and Bridal Shop Reach Deal

INDIANAPOLIS, IN– A lawsuit filed by the Indiana Attorney General against a bridal shop has been settled. The owner of “I Do Bridal” was accused of deceptive practices that led to several brides not being able to get their wedding dresses on time for their big day. That owner, Tesia Lapp, has agreed to not open another bridal shop without getting a 75-thousand-dollar bond, and she also has to promise to never commit any more deceptive or unfair business transactions.
